“It would be mind-blowing” to win Best Comedy Series at the Emmy Awards, “Transparent” creator/writer/director Jill Soloway confesses on the red carpet of the TV academy’s recent event saluting this year’s nominated producers. “It would be crazy. When we tell Soloway that Jeffrey Tambor is predicted to win the Emmy for Best Actor, she smiles, “I know. I follow Gold Derby every few hours. It’s the only website in the world that’s actually doing real-time Emmy predictions. That’s all I care about.”
Soloway is also up for Best Writing (“Pilot”) and Best Directing (“Best New Girl”) at the Emmys, so she could be a rare triple threat come Sunday. Her favorite section of our website? “The part where it says I’m gonna win the writing award,” Soloway jokes.
When we ask her to tease Season 2 of the breakout Amazon comedy, she reveals that newly crowned Emmy champ Bradley Whitford will return to the show, but that he’ll be playing a new character this time around. She admits, “It’s wild, it’s wacky, it’s crazy. We’re taking huge risks. We’re walking a tightrope. It’s gonna be filled with surprises. It’s gonna be a really emotional season.”
